LCG Commands - Overview
LCG is short for: LHC Computing Grid
LHC is short for: Large Hadron Collider
This list is taken from the glite 3.0 User Guide (PDF).
Command | Description |
lcg-cp |
Copies a Grid file to a local destination (download). |
lcg-cr |
Copies a file to a SE and registers the file in the catalog (LFC or LRC) (upload). |
lcg-del |
Deletes one file (either one replica or all replicas). |
lcg-rep |
Copies a file from one SE to another SE and registers it in the catalog (LFC or LRC) (replicate). |
lcg-gt |
Gets the TURL for a given SURL and transfer protocol. |
lcg-sd |
Sets file status to Done for a given SURL in an SRM’s request. |
lcg-aa |
Adds an alias in the catalog (LFC or RMC) for a given GUID. |
lcg-ra |
Removes an alias in the catalog (LFC or RMC) for a given GUID. |
lcg-rf |
Registers in the the catalog (LFC or LRC/RMC), a file residing on an SE. |
lcg-uf |
Unregisters in the the catalog (LFC or LRC) a file residing on an SE. |
lcg-la |
Lists the aliases for a given LFN, GUID or SURL. |
lcg-lg |
Gets the GUID for a given LFN or SURL. |
lcg-lr |
Lists the replicas for a given LFN, GUID or SURL. |
